

It is with profound sadness that we announce the passing of Ted Stephen Hunt, a beloved husband, father, grandfather, great-grandfather, brother, educator, and adventurer. Ted passed away peacefully surrounded by his loving family on December 18, 2024.
Ted was the devoted husband of Diane Hunt and the cherished father of Ted Hunt Jr., Joshua Hunt, Michelle Hays, and Henry Browning. He was a proud grandfather to six grandchildren and great-grandfather to two. Ted’s siblings include Earl Hunt Jr. (deceased), Michael Hunt (deceased), Susan Stewart, and Cindy Steward Mackes.
Ted dedicated his life to education, serving as a teacher, mentor, and friend to countless students and colleagues. His passion for learning, storytelling, and encouraging others defined his remarkable career. Ted authored written works that continue to inspire and educate, further cementing his legacy as a lifelong educator and guide.
Outside the classroom, Ted’s adventurous spirit shone brightly. His love for history—especially tales of ghosts and Spanish shipwrecks—fueled his passion for diving, treasure hunting, and exploration. Whether diving into underwater worlds, tracing his family’s ancestry, or wandering far-off lands, Ted embraced life with curiosity and joy.
Known for his warmth and humor, Ted was a storyteller at heart, captivating loved ones with tales of daring escapades over a rum and Coke. He lived with boundless enthusiasm, cherishing time with family and friends while always dreaming of his next adventure.
A proud member of the Masonic Order, Ted also found fulfillment in his contributions to the community, embodying the values of service, integrity, and fellowship.
A celebration of Ted’s life will be held on January 17, 2025.
Ted Stephen Hunt lived a life full of passion, purpose, and love. His legacy will live on in the hearts of all who knew him. He will be deeply missed but forever remembered with gratitude and affection.
